Charging and discharging control device for secondary battery
First Claim
1. A charging and discharging control device for a secondary battery, said control device comprising:
- discharging control means for stopping discharging of said secondary battery when a voltage thereof becomes less than a predetermined discharge stop voltage during discharging of said secondary battery;
charging control means for stopping charging of said secondary battery when the voltage thereof is in excess of a predetermined charge stop voltage during charging of said secondary battery; and
history estimating means for estimating the charging/discharging history of said secondary battery on the basis of condition thereof;
wherein said discharging control means corrects said predetermined discharge stop voltage so as to be increased corresponding to the charging/discharging history estimated by said history estimating means;
wherein said charging control means corrects said predetermined charge stop voltage so as to be decreased corresponding to the charging/discharging history estimated by said history estimating means,wherein said secondary battery consists of a plurality of secondary batteries connected with each other;
wherein said charging control means includes current changing means which, in case that a charging voltage in a specified secondary battery reaches said predetermined charge stop voltage, directs a flow of charging current to the other secondary batteries by a by-pass operation of the flow of charging current; and
wherein said history estimating means estimates the charging/discharging history of said secondary battery on the basis of a number of said by-pass operations.

Abstract
A charging and discharging control device for a secondary battery includes a secondary battery, a controller, a charging unit for charging the battery, a ON/OFF switch between the battery and the charging unit and a control switch for controlling the discharge current. At charging the battery, the ON/OFF switch is turned on and a voltage Ve of the secondary battery is compared with a charge stop voltage Vmax by the controller. If Ve≧Vmax, the charging operation is ended. At discharging, the control is turned on and the voltage Ve is compared with a discharge stop voltage Vmin. If Ve≦Vmin, the discharging operation is ended. Corresponding to charging/discharging history of the battery, the controller corrects the voltage Vmin so as to be increased and the voltage Vmax so as to be decreased, whereby the life span of the secondary battery can be extended.
